I have a breeding pair of fiery shoulder conures and one of them died suddenly this afternoon. I was feeding the flock, and just as I filled the seed dish in the cage above, one of the fiery shoulders started screeching. I thought maybe it had caught a nail on the wire, but then it fell over onto its back and started to flutter its wings. I reached in and picked it up , and a minute later it was dead.

They haven't really been handled, but they aren't terrified of me. I talk to each pair when I feed them, and all of the birds come to the dishes before I'm even done with their cage. I try to feed at the same time each day to keep things consistent. I doubt I scared it to death. Each pair gets three bowls each day. Fresh seed and pellets, fresh veggies, and clean, cool water. I think they eat a pretty healthy diet, and their cages are big enough for them to fly. They aren't clipped either and the only time they are handled it to get their nails clipped when they need it.

Does this sound like a heart attack ?
